Abstract

A wearable audio output device (e.g., headphones) having an open design that allows ambient noise to pass to a listener without physically isolating the listener from a surrounding environment. The device may include an open earcup design that may partially or completely surround the listener's ear, and in some examples a portion of the listener's head may be uncovered by the open earcup. To improve comfort, the device includes a floating audio component configured to generate output audio in a direction of the listener's ear without contacting the listener's ear. To reduce audio leakage into the environment, the floating audio component may include two audio transducers and perform beamforming to target the output audio toward the listener's ear and cancel the output audio in other directions. For example, the beamforming may cause constructive interference in one direction and destructive interference in all other directions.
